The Ethical Landscape of AI: Navigating Bias and Responsibility

Artificial intelligence expands at an unprecedented rate, transforming industries and shaping our daily lives. This rapid progression however, presents critical ethical questions. Bias in AI algorithms can reinforce existing societal disparities, leading to discriminatory outcomes. Moreover, the accountability for AI-driven decisions remains a complex and dynamic landscape.

To counteract these concerns, it is essential to foster ethical principles in the implementation of AI systems. This here requires open algorithms, thorough testing for bias, and mechanisms to affirm human oversight and liability.

Navigating these ethical dilemmas is not merely a algorithmic exercise but a humanitarian imperative.

The Future of Work in an AI-Driven World

As artificial intelligence progresses at a rapid rate, its effect on the future of work is a topic of both anticipation and concern. While AI has the capacity to optimize many tasks, it also presents dilemmas for the workforce. Some analysts predict a shift in the nature of work, with partnership between humans and AI becoming more ubiquitous.

The requirement for competencies such as critical thinking, innovation, and interpersonal skills is expected to grow. Workers will need to adjust their expertise to remain competitive. Upskilling systems will play a crucial role in empowering the workforce for the days ahead.
